Description

¼ Rupie - Wilhelm II from German East Africa. Issued from 1891 to 1901. Struck in Silver (.917). Measures 19.2 mm and weighs 2.92 g.

Obverse
Bust of William II in military uniform facing right and wearing the Prussian helmet topped by a crowned Hohenzollern eagle.
Reverse
Coat of arms of the company with the year below, value and denomination below. (German East Africa Company)
Edge
Reeded
